Core Insights - The article highlights the integration of the "Kua Fu" humanoid robot by Leju with NVIDIA Jetson Thor, showcasing its capabilities in various industrial applications, which accelerates the commercialization of robotics technology [1][3][19] Group 1: Technology Integration - The "Kua Fu" humanoid robot features over 40 degrees of freedom, providing unprecedented flexibility and adaptability for complex industrial tasks [5] - NVIDIA Jetson Thor enhances the robot's AI computing performance by 7.5 times compared to traditional solutions, ensuring stable processing of multimodal data streams [5][19] Group 2: Industrial Applications - In logistics, "Kua Fu" demonstrates long-term stable sorting performance, overcoming traditional challenges of accuracy degradation over time [8] - The robot successfully executes a full process operation in SMT material tray retrieval, showcasing its precision in a manufacturing environment [10] - In the 3C electronics sector, "Kua Fu" achieves millisecond-level response times for identification and sorting, supporting high-speed production lines [12] - During automotive assembly, the robot adapts to various container sizes and weights, illustrating its flexibility in non-structured environments [15] - In daily chemical production, "Kua Fu" performs complex tasks with smooth operation, validating its capabilities in intricate task execution [17] Group 3: Future Prospects - The successful integration of advanced robotics hardware with AI computing power is seen as a key driver for the evolution of humanoid robots from standardized industrial applications to more flexible, general-purpose scenarios [19] - Leju's ongoing efforts in training and optimizing robots in real environments are expected to further enhance their performance and accelerate the commercialization process [19]
